Fleas and small mites are common when baby squirrels first come from the nest. If the squirrel is furless than a warm bath with a couple drops of Dawn Dishwashing Liquid will solve this problem.

Dust bathing is common in mammals and especially small rodents. Squirrels, chinchillas, degus, hamsters, and some species of rat bathe in this way. Dust bathing removes grime, loose hairs and excess oils from a squirrel’s coat in the same way water would but without the risk of prolonged dampness.

How soon should you gut a squirrel?

You should gut furred small game as soon as possible. Especially rabbits and hares, because there’s something about their innards that allows them to sour very quickly.F

How do you clean a squirrel carcass?

Get the squirrel thoroughly wet before starting. You can either soak the carcass in a bucket of water or spray it down with a hose. Getting the carcass wet before you begin cleaning it will help prevent hair from getting stuck on the meat. Getting the carcass wet will also help loosen it if it’s become stiff.
